Rubber belt conveyor system
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of coal transportation, and particularly relates to a rubber belt conveyor system.
Background
The conventional belt conveyor is generally provided with more conveying belt storage bins (generally 6 sections and 3 meters per section) in order to provide a tensioning trolley moving space and store redundant belts, but the conveying belt storage bins occupy a large underground space, so that the limited underground space is smaller, the coal mining stopping line position must move backwards to realize normal tower connection of the belt conveyor and a transfer conveyor due to the space occupied by the conveying belt storage bins, and the backward movement of the coal mining stopping line position inevitably reduces the recovery rate of coal resources. If simple removal transportation belt storage area storehouse then can bring transportation belt storage area storehouse space limited, lead to tensioning dolly activity space to reduce, and then lead to unable tensioning belt.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ention provides a rubber belt conveyor system which is used for solving the technical problem of coal mining stopping line position backward displacement caused by large occupied space of a conveying belt storage bin.

Fig. 1 is a schematic diagram illustrating a composition of a belt conveyor system according to an embodiment of the present invention, fig. 2 is a schematic diagram illustrating an automatic deviation rectification principle of a tensioning trolley according to an embodiment of the present invention, fig. 3 is a schematic diagram illustrating a connection relationship between the tensioning trolley and a traction winch according to an embodiment of the present invention, and the belt conveyor system according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to fig. 1 to 3.
As shown in fig. 1, the system of the belt conveyor 1 mainly comprises a belt conveyor 1, a conveying belt storage bin 2, a belt rack rod bracket, a belt storage bin H rack, a rack rod 7, a roller, a tensioning trolley 12 and a traction winch 13.
Specifically, the large frame of the belt conveyor 1 is connected with the conveying belt storage bin 2 through a connecting piece. Here, the connection mode of the large frame and the belt conveying storage bin of the belt conveyor 1 is a connection mode commonly adopted in the prior art, and the detailed description is omitted here.
Install first belt hack lever bracket 3 in proper order every 3 meters from rubber belt conveyor 1's big frame end, first belt storage area storehouse H frame 5, second belt storage area storehouse H frame 6 and second belt hack lever bracket 4, hack lever 7 is laid at first belt hack lever bracket 3, first belt storage area storehouse H frame 5, second belt storage area storehouse H frame 6 and second belt hack lever bracket 4 top surface, hack lever 7 is contained angle theta with rubber belt conveyor 1 place plane, theta's scope is 0 degrees < theta < 90 degrees, install belt upper roll 11 on hack lever 7. It should be noted that an included angle θ between the rack bar 7 and the plane of the belt conveyor 1 is a relative included angle, and the tower-connected end of the rack bar 7 and the belt conveyor 1 is the highest point, that is, the rack bar 7 is inclined downward relative to the belt conveyor 1. In addition, the hack lever 7 is horizontal with the infrastructure surface on which the hack lever 7 is located, i.e. the infrastructure surface on which the hack lever 7 is located is also inclined downwards, which can leave enough space for the installation of the conveyor belt magazine 2.
The transportation belt storage belt bin 2 is located below the hack lever 7, the transportation belt storage belt bin 2 comprises a storage belt bin base frame 21 and storage belt bin frame legs 22, two trolley tracks are laid in the transportation belt storage belt bin 2, and a base of the tensioning trolley 12 is placed on the trolley tracks. Transport belt stores up and takes storehouse 2 and installs in the space of hack lever 7 below on the whole, thereby the space of hack lever 7 below of reasonable utilization like this has reduced transport belt and has stored up taking storehouse 2 and taking other spaces to the transport belt of this application embodiment than prior art all has obvious reduction in height and length, transport belt after simple and easy stores up and takes storehouse 2 and satisfying necessary tensioning and store up under the area function prerequisite, the occupation in space has been reduced greatly, the effectual space in the pit that has released, and it is also convenient to install. The tensioning trolley 12 is still arranged in the transportation belt storage bin 2, but the tensioning trolley 12 of the embodiment of the application is improved again, so that the size of the tensioning trolley 12 is reduced, and the transportation belt storage bin 2 with reduced space is adapted.
The first belt rack rod bracket 3, the first belt storage bin H rack 5, the second belt storage bin H rack 6 and the second belt rack rod bracket 4 are respectively provided with a first roller 81, a second roller 82, a third roller 83 and a fourth roller 84, one end of the transportation belt storage bin 2 close to the big rack of the belt conveyor 1 is provided with a fifth roller 85, the tensioning trolley 12 is provided with a sixth roller 86, a seventh roller 87 and an eighth roller 88 are sequentially arranged from the working face tower connection end of the belt conveyor 1, and the position of the big rack of the belt conveyor 1 is sequentially provided with a first driving roller 9 and a second driving roller 10 from one end close to the transportation belt storage bin 2. Wherein, the first roller 81, the sixth roller 86 and the seventh roller 87 are 320 rollers, and the belt passes through the 320 rollers according to the tension and belt storage requirement; the second roller 82, the third roller 83, the fifth roller 85 and the eighth roller 88 are rollers 200, and the rollers 200 act as pressure belts to prevent the belts from rubbing against the frame. The belt passes through the belt upper supporting roller 11, the seventh roller 87, the eighth roller 88, the first driving roller 9, the second driving roller 10, the fifth roller 85, the sixth roller 86, the first roller 81, the second roller 82, the third roller 83 and the fourth roller 84 in sequence. After the belt storage bin 2 and the tensioning trolley 12 are installed below the frame rods 7, in order to continue the tensioning function, the extension path of the belt needs to be changed to tension and store the belt in a limited space. The first to eighth cylinders 88, the first driving cylinder 9 and the second driving cylinder 10 of the embodiment of the application are installed at appropriate positions, and the belt passes through the cylinders, so that the effective space of the transportation belt storage bin 2 is ingeniously utilized, and the transportation belt storage bin 2 still has good tensioning and belt storage functions below the frame rods 7.
The traction winch 13 is arranged at the head position of the belt conveyor 1, and the tensioning trolley 12 is connected with the traction winch 13 through a traction steel wire rope 14. Besides the above reasonable belt threading manner, another key factor is that the tensioning trolley 12 moves back and forth on the trolley track in the belt storage bin 2, and the movement of the belt is driven by the movement of the tensioning trolley 12, so that the belt is tensioned. Because the tensioning trolley 12 does not have a direct driving device, the tensioning trolley 12 is connected with the traction winch 13 through the traction steel wire rope 14, and the traction winch 13 realizes the movement of the tensioning trolley 12 through the retraction of the traction steel wire rope 14.
When the tensioning trolley 12 drives the belt to move, the belt is inevitably deviated when the belt is stressed unevenly, and if the tensioning trolley 12 cannot be timely tensioned unstably and cannot be accurately realized, the tensioning trolley 12, the trolley track and the belt are abraded, so that the service life of the tensioning trolley is shortened. In order to solve the above technical problem, the present embodiment provides a preferred implementation manner, and the roller base of the tensioning trolley 12 is connected with the trolley track through a pin. As shown in fig. 2, the principle of the automatic deviation correction of the tensioning trolley 12 is that the roller seat of the tensioning trolley 12 is connected with the trolley track through a pin shaft, and after the belt is wound on the sixth roller 86, when the stress of the belt acting on one side of the sixth roller 86 is increased, the roller seat of the sixth roller 86 deviates to the other side, the belt is driven to move to the other side, balance is automatically formed, and the belt deviation caused by the large stress of one side of the belt is prevented.
As a preferred implementation manner provided by the embodiment of the present application, the tensioning trolley 12 is provided with a rail clamping device 15, and the rail clamping device 15 enables the tensioning trolley 12 to be stably connected with the trolley track, so as to prevent the tensioning trolley 12 from being separated from the trolley track.
Tensioning dolly 12 when moving on the dolly track, when reacing dolly track end, can be because the effect of inertia can not accurate control tensioning dolly 12 stop, the orbital problem of dolly that dashes out appears even, in order to solve above technical problem, this application embodiment provides an optimal implementation mode, stores up the tape storage storehouse at the conveyer belt 2 both ends and installs limiting plate 16 respectively, can be blockked by limiting plate 16 when tensioning dolly 12 reachs 2 ends in conveyer belt storage storehouse like this, prevents that it from dashing out the dolly track.
As a preferred implementation manner provided by the emb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 1 and fig. 3, a tail pulley fixing seat 17 is fixedly installed below the frame rod 7 and at one end close to the transportation belt storage bin 2, a tail pulley 18 is fixedly installed on the tail pulley fixing seat 17, and the traction steel wire rope 14 passes through the tail pulley 18 and is connected with the tensioning trolley 12. The traction steel wire rope 14 passes through the tail pulley 18 to be connected with the tensioning trolley 12, so that the traction winch 13 pulls the tensioning trolley 12 in a stable driving back mode to realize belt tensioning.
In addition, the system is also provided with an anti-skid device, a smoke alarm, a temperature detector, an automatic watering device, a coal piling device and an anti-deviation device. Antiskid, smoke alarm, temperature detector, automatic watering device, coal piling device, prevent that the off tracking device is six big protection component of belt conveyor, and its mounting means and mounted position are the same among the prior art, and the here is no longer repeated.
The rubber belt conveyor system provided by the embodiment of the application has the following technical effects:
1. the rubber belt conveying system of the system is complete in protection device, belt tensioning and automatic deviation rectification are achieved through the simple tensioning trolley, the system is safe to operate, and performance is stable.
2. The system is simple and effective in modification design, easy to machine and install and capable of being recycled.
3. The simple belt storage bin has low manufacturing cost and wide applicability, and can be used for mining on all working faces.
4. By using the simple rubber belt conveyor, about 15 meters more can be recovered compared with the prior art, and more than 2 ten thousand tons of coal resources can be recovered (calculated according to the height of a working face and the inclined length of 150 meters).
